What is the Little River Band of Ottawa Indians' traditional territory called?

  • Anishinaabe Aki

  • Iroquois Confederacy

  • Cherokee Nation

  • Navajo Nation

Answer

The traditional territory of the Little River Band of Ottawa Indians is called Anishinaabe Aki, which means "Land of the Anishinaabe" in the Odawa language. This territory includes parts of Michigan, Wisconsin, and Ontario, Canada.
